当前位置: 首页 > news >正文

YOLOv11分割标注转换终极指南:一键搞定掩码与多边形互转

YOLOv11分割标注转换终极指南:一键搞定掩码与多边形互转

【免费下载链接】ultralyticsultralytics - 提供 YOLOv8 模型,用于目标检测、图像分割、姿态估计和图像分类,适合机器学习和计算机视觉领域的开发者。项目地址: https://gitcode.com/GitHub_Trending/ul/ultralytics

还在为分割标注格式转换头疼吗?🤔 每次面对COCO格式和YOLO格式的互转,是不是感觉在解一道复杂的数学题?别担心,今天这篇攻略将用最轻松的方式,带你快速掌握YOLOv11标注转换的秘诀!

从"小白"到"高手":标注转换那些事儿

想象一下这样的场景:你费尽心思标注了一个数据集,结果发现模型不认这个格式!😱 这就是为什么我们需要掌握标注转换技能。

掩码标注就像给图片涂色,每个像素都被标记,精度高但数据量大;多边形标注则像连点成线,用关键点勾勒轮廓,数据小但需要转换。简单说,一个是"像素级"的精确,一个是"轮廓级"的简洁。

图:YOLOv11分割任务中标注格式的典型应用场景

三步搞定:标注转换的傻瓜式操作

第一步:环境准备超简单

只需要一行命令,就能搭建好转换环境:

pip install ultralytics

没错,就这么简单!不需要复杂的配置,不需要漫长的等待。

第二步:核心转换一键完成

打开你的Python编辑器,输入这几行魔法代码:

from ultralytics.data.converter import convert_coco convert_coco( labels_dir="你的COCO标注文件夹", save_dir="转换后的YOLO标注", use_segments=True )

这个convert_coco函数就是我们的秘密武器,它隐藏在ultralytics/data/converter.py模块中,专门负责处理各种复杂的标注转换。

第三步:结果验证秒知道

转换完成后,怎么知道效果好不好呢?用官方自带的可视化工具看一眼就知道了!👀

实战案例:COCO转YOLO全流程

假设你手头有一个COCO格式的数据集,目录结构长这样:

我的数据集/ ├── 标注文件/ │ └── 训练标注.json └── 图片文件夹/ └── 训练图片/

运行转换代码后,你会得到YOLO格式的标注文件,每个文件的内容大概是这样:

0 0.123 0.456 0.789 0.234 ... # 类别ID + 归一化坐标

避坑指南:这些坑我都帮你踩过了

坑点1:多段轮廓怎么办?有时候一个目标会被分成好几段轮廓,就像拼图一样。别担心,转换工具会自动帮你把这些"拼图"拼起来,形成一个完整的多边形。

坑点2:类别映射搞晕了?COCO有91个类别,但YOLO通常用80个,转换工具会自动帮你做好映射,你只需要告诉它要转换就行了!

高级玩法:让转换效率翻倍

如果你的数据集特别大,比如有几十万张图片,可以试试多线程转换:

from concurrent.futures import ThreadPoolExecutor # 同时处理多个文件,速度嗖嗖的!

完整工具链:从标注到训练一气呵成

整个流程就像搭积木一样简单:

  1. 准备标注→ 2.格式转换→ 3.模型训练→ 4.效果验证

每个环节都有对应的工具支持,你只需要按照步骤操作就行了。

总结:标注转换其实很简单

记住这几个要点,你就能轻松应对各种标注转换需求:

理解两种格式的核心差异掌握一键转换的核心函数学会验证转换结果了解常见问题的解决方案

现在,拿起你的数据集,开始尝试转换吧!相信用不了多久,你就能成为标注转换的小能手!🎉

如果遇到问题,记得查看官方文档,或者在社区里寻求帮助。技术之路,我们一起成长!

【免费下载链接】ultralyticsultralytics - 提供 YOLOv8 模型,用于目标检测、图像分割、姿态估计和图像分类,适合机器学习和计算机视觉领域的开发者。项目地址: https://gitcode.com/GitHub_Trending/ul/ultralytics

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

http://www.jsqmd.com/news/89763/

相关文章:

  • sudo usermod -L username和sudo usermod -s /sbin/nologin
  • Quill图片调整模块:5分钟快速上手终极指南
  • SDUT Java---jdbc
  • openMES开源制造执行系统:从零部署到生产智能化的完整指南
  • 第55天(简单题中等题 数据结构)
  • C#开发者必知的100个黑科技(前50)!从主构造函数到源生成器全面掌握
  • Unity反向遮罩终极指南:打造惊艳UI特效的5个秘诀
  • 飞书文档批量导出工具完整使用指南
  • nchu_两次电路模拟大作业及课堂测验总结
  • 行业聚焦:2025年四通球阀制造厂家权威排名TOP10,市场上四通球阀公司推荐排行优选实力品牌 - 品牌推荐师
  • Source Han Serif TTF:开源中文字体的完美解决方案
  • KeymouseGo深度解析:解放双手的智能自动化实践手册
  • ros2常用命令
  • AMD处理器性能调优进阶实战:深度掌握Ryzen SDT调试工具
  • 固定球阀优质供应商排行,采购必看指南,固定球阀排行双达阀门发展迅速,实力雄厚 - 品牌推荐师
  • qy_蓝桥杯编程系列_编程22 不停的上课
  • GPU显存健康诊断:memtest_vulkan全面评测与实战指南
  • GPU显存健康诊断:memtest_vulkan全面评测与实战指南
  • 如何用OneMore插件实现终极笔记管理:开源免费的效率神器
  • 无锡地铁广告投放费用排行,高口碑供应商盘点,地铁站广告/电梯框架广告/应援广告/社区广告/电梯广告/电梯电子屏广告地铁广告采购有哪些 - 品牌推荐师
  • 题目集4~5以及课堂测验的总结Blog
  • ArkLights明日方舟终极自动化助手:一站式解放双手的完整解决方案
  • 5步掌握Python多尺度地理加权回归实战:从数据准备到结果解读
  • 联想拯救者工具箱:硬件优化与性能控制的终极解决方案
  • OpenWrt路由解锁网易云音乐全攻略:从零部署到高阶配置
  • 2025最新车牌识别/道闸/门禁/通道闸/停车场/人脸门禁公司首选骏通智能——智慧出入管理解决方案优选供应商 - 全局中转站
  • Easy-Scraper:零代码网页数据采集终极解决方案
  • iOS调试兼容性终极解决方案:全版本DeviceSupport文件使用指南
  • PiKVM硬件选型指南:从入门到专业部署的完整方案
  • 从 PRM 到 G-E:推荐重排架构的范式升级与工业实践